Victorian Outdoor/Active Recreation Initiative of the Year
Wheel Women - Cycling



Tina McCarthy and Wheel Women Cycling are commended for changing the face of women’s recreational cycling. Tina displays the attributes of an authentic, honest and realistic role model and her commitment to help women of all shapes and sizes choose an active lifestyle through cycling is outstanding and well recognised. As a group, Wheel Women has changed the face of how to engage women in cycling. Throughout 2017, Tina and Wheel Women have contributed greatly to the increased participation of women in recreational cycling. With no aims of competition or racing, the focus at Wheel Women is to engage women in cycling from a purely recreational and non-competitive level. This then builds the landscape for future development of riders should they wish to pursue competition. In 2017 over 300 women across Melbourne engaged in Wheel Women cycling initiatives in different ways: skills sessions, group rides and cycling events. Wheel Women has successfully entered the largest all-women team into the 'Around The Bay in A Day' ride since 2013 and assembled an 80 women strong women’s ride at the Tour Down Under event in January 2017.
